Delen via


QueryContext interface

Hiermee definieert u de querycontext die Bing voor de aanvraag heeft gebruikt.

Eigenschappen

adultIntent

Een Booleaanse waarde die aangeeft of de opgegeven query een intentie voor volwassenen heeft. De waarde is waar als de query een intentie voor volwassenen heeft; anders, onwaar. OPMERKING: Deze eigenschap wordt niet geserialiseerd. Deze kan alleen worden ingevuld door de server.

alterationOverrideQuery

De queryreeks die moet worden gebruikt om Bing te dwingen de oorspronkelijke tekenreeks te gebruiken. Als de querytekenreeks bijvoorbeeld 'saling downwind' is, is de override-querytekenreeks '+saling downwind'. Vergeet niet om de querytekenreeks te coderen die resulteert in '%2Bsaling+downwind'. Dit veld is alleen opgenomen als de oorspronkelijke querytekenreeks een spelfout bevat. OPMERKING: Deze eigenschap wordt niet geserialiseerd. Deze kan alleen worden ingevuld door de server.

alteredQuery

De queryreeks die door Bing wordt gebruikt om de query uit te voeren. Bing gebruikt de gewijzigde querytekenreeks als de oorspronkelijke querytekenreeks spelfouten bevat. Als de querytekenreeks bijvoorbeeld 'saling downwind' is, is de gewijzigde querytekenreeks 'zeilend'. Dit veld is alleen opgenomen als de oorspronkelijke querytekenreeks een spelfout bevat. OPMERKING: Deze eigenschap wordt niet geserialiseerd. Deze kan alleen worden ingevuld door de server.

askUserForLocation

Een Booleaanse waarde die aangeeft of Bing de locatie van de gebruiker vereist om nauwkeurige resultaten te bieden. Als u de locatie van de gebruiker hebt opgegeven met behulp van de headers X-MSEdge-ClientIP en X-Search-Location, kunt u dit veld negeren. Voor locatiebewuste query's, zoals 'het weer van vandaag' of 'restaurants in de buurt' die de locatie van de gebruiker nodig hebben om nauwkeurige resultaten te geven, is dit veld ingesteld op waar. Voor locatiebewuste query's met de locatie (bijvoorbeeld 'Seattle weather'), is dit veld ingesteld op onwaar. Dit veld is ook ingesteld op onwaar voor query's die geen locatiebewust zijn, zoals 'aanbevolen verkopers'. OPMERKING: Deze eigenschap wordt niet geserialiseerd. Deze kan alleen worden ingevuld door de server.

isTransactional

OPMERKING: Deze eigenschap wordt niet geserialiseerd. Deze kan alleen worden ingevuld door de server.

originalQuery

De querytekenreeks zoals opgegeven in de aanvraag.

Eigenschapdetails

adultIntent

Een Booleaanse waarde die aangeeft of de opgegeven query een intentie voor volwassenen heeft. De waarde is waar als de query een intentie voor volwassenen heeft; anders, onwaar. OPMERKING: Deze eigenschap wordt niet geserialiseerd. Deze kan alleen worden ingevuld door de server.

adultIntent?: boolean

Waarde van eigenschap

boolean

alterationOverrideQuery

De queryreeks die moet worden gebruikt om Bing te dwingen de oorspronkelijke tekenreeks te gebruiken. Als de querytekenreeks bijvoorbeeld 'saling downwind' is, is de override-querytekenreeks '+saling downwind'. Vergeet niet om de querytekenreeks te coderen die resulteert in '%2Bsaling+downwind'. Dit veld is alleen opgenomen als de oorspronkelijke querytekenreeks een spelfout bevat. OPMERKING: Deze eigenschap wordt niet geserialiseerd. Deze kan alleen worden ingevuld door de server.

alterationOverrideQuery?: string

Waarde van eigenschap

string

alteredQuery

De queryreeks die door Bing wordt gebruikt om de query uit te voeren. Bing gebruikt de gewijzigde querytekenreeks als de oorspronkelijke querytekenreeks spelfouten bevat. Als de querytekenreeks bijvoorbeeld 'saling downwind' is, is de gewijzigde querytekenreeks 'zeilend'. Dit veld is alleen opgenomen als de oorspronkelijke querytekenreeks een spelfout bevat. OPMERKING: Deze eigenschap wordt niet geserialiseerd. Deze kan alleen worden ingevuld door de server.

alteredQuery?: string

Waarde van eigenschap

string

askUserForLocation

Een Booleaanse waarde die aangeeft of Bing de locatie van de gebruiker vereist om nauwkeurige resultaten te bieden. Als u de locatie van de gebruiker hebt opgegeven met behulp van de headers X-MSEdge-ClientIP en X-Search-Location, kunt u dit veld negeren. Voor locatiebewuste query's, zoals 'het weer van vandaag' of 'restaurants in de buurt' die de locatie van de gebruiker nodig hebben om nauwkeurige resultaten te geven, is dit veld ingesteld op waar. Voor locatiebewuste query's met de locatie (bijvoorbeeld 'Seattle weather'), is dit veld ingesteld op onwaar. Dit veld is ook ingesteld op onwaar voor query's die geen locatiebewust zijn, zoals 'aanbevolen verkopers'. OPMERKING: Deze eigenschap wordt niet geserialiseerd. Deze kan alleen worden ingevuld door de server.

askUserForLocation?: boolean

Waarde van eigenschap

boolean

isTransactional

OPMERKING: Deze eigenschap wordt niet geserialiseerd. Deze kan alleen worden ingevuld door de server.

isTransactional?: boolean

Waarde van eigenschap

boolean

originalQuery

De querytekenreeks zoals opgegeven in de aanvraag.

originalQuery: string

Waarde van eigenschap

string